OP has no reason to lie. First part of the Story sounds sensible and credible (getting an experienced manager alongside would seem sensible - a straight firing would cost £££, SISU savvy enough to know that it would mean SP would take a lower pay-off rather than have the humilation and reputational damage).

Bit about walking away not quite accurate, but SISU will not want relegation under any circumstance.

At the moment SISU own a club potentially 1 promotion away from being in a good (well at least better) financial situation, 2 promotions away from balancing off their initial investment.

A relegation makes it less likely and digs them further into the already huge hole they are in.

They simply cannot afford to walk away, a debt is only a loss when it crystallises. At the moment they can shield the debt from their investors, probably by creative accounting.

The story stacks up to me.

What is pertinent is that a 3rd tier club with (undeniable) massive potential is a better lure for a potential buyer than one in the 4th tier by some distance.

The Prem is where the money is (more so now than ever) and there are some investors who will still see CCFC as viable in getting there.

If SISU put a good manager in place and start moving up then they have a good chance of getting out with a reduced damage sustained.

Champ clubs with potential cost £££ and now below that there is probably only us, Bristol City, possibly Preston who could have a fan base as to fit in long term in the Prem at this level. (SUFC recently taken over).

Portsmouth, Plymouth etc are too far down the pyramid to be invested in on the same basis.

Anyway, point is that SISU want out, but cannot afford to be in the category of PFC or PAFC.

I do genuinely think that if we got into a position to challenge then SISU would find some extra money - they do have access to it, just not the appetite at present and I don't blame them tbh. Would you give money to SP, AT or CC?

I wouldn't.

The next appointment is crucial.

I would go for RM on that basis.
